Pricing and Inclusions

private-tour-from-san-pedro-de-atacama-chile-to-the-salar-de-uyuni

The private tour from San Pedro de Atacama to Salar de Uyuni starts at $2,300 per person, with the final price varying based on group size.

The tour includes:

  • All transfers and transportation in a comfortable 4×4

  • Spanish-speaking driver and professional bilingual guide

  • Complete meals: 3 lunches, 2 dinners, 2 breakfasts (including vegan and vegetarian options)

Plus, travelers have access to an oxygen tank and satellite phone, and entrance fees to all tourist attractions are covered.

The tour also provides private transfers to various destinations, such as La Paz, Potosí, Sucre, and Villazón.

Preparing for the Tour

When embarking on this private tour from San Pedro de Atacama to the Salar de Uyuni, a few key preparations are essential.

First, ensure you pack appropriately for the varying altitudes and climates – layers, sun protection, and comfortable walking shoes.

Second, familiarize yourself with the itinerary and plan accordingly, as the remote locations may have limited amenities.

Lastly, be prepared for the moderate physical fitness required, as the tour involves some hiking and exploring.
